Data and Its Impact On Pace of Play at Public and Private Golf Courses

DATA AND ITS IMPACT ON PACE OF PLAY AT PUBLIC AND PRIVATE COURSES

By Elvis Anderson

Our conversation with Tagmarshal CEO Bodo Sieber, prompted memory of a great Yogi Berra quote.

“Nobody goes there anymore, it’s too crowded.”

Tagmarshal’s aim is to be, “the leading golf course efficiencies and field management solution. The system uses a series of GPS “tags” that work with both cart and walking courses – clipped onto one golf bag per group or installed into carts. Algorithms identify risk groups and empower courses to provide accurate, objective support to alleviate pace challenges before they arise, reducing average round times and materially improving the pace experience.”.

Ultimately, Tagmarshal helps manage pace of play. Golfers want it so they can play more golf in less time and golf courses want it to better organize their tee sheet. A better flow is the aim and gathered data prevents bottlenecks or delays.

“Eight of the top 10 public golf courses in the States are using Tagmarshal. We help resorts such as Kohler and Erin Hills provide a better guest experience. And we help private clubs by providing valuable data which enables them to send fast players off early and slower players after,” Sieber tells World’s Best Golf Destinations.

The data gathered by Tagmarshal is more specific than a marshal sitting under a tree on the fourth hole with a stop watch. The data will point out pace of play surges or stoppages and enables a marshal to have a more productive conversation with guests or members.

Sieber uses a commercial flight to explain the benefits of Tagmarshal, “Imagine flying plane at 80-percent occupancy versus 95-percent. The difference over a year is substantial.”

The data will put an end to pro shop debates because numbers don’t lie. Imagine a head professional sitting down with a member and reviewing the information:

“Mr. Jones, we have data here from your previous five rounds. You’re a fast player on the first 12 holes, but after your eighth beer – things get a bit loose which is fine, but please be aware. If you get pressed from behind – please let them go ahead.”

Use of Tagmarshal Intelligence Systems Increase by 275%

USE OF TAGMARSHAL INTELLIGENCE SYSTEM INCREASE BY 275%

COURSES ADD $7.5 MILLION IN GREEN FEES, REDUCE PACE OF PLAY BY UP TO 30 MINUTES

(ATLANTA, Ga.) – Tagmarshal – golf intelligence and pace-of-play system coveted by golf courses, country clubs and resorts globally – has increased the number of installs by 275% over the past 12 months.

After the first three months implementing Tagmarshal, courses reduced average round times by 14 minutes and realized a combined $7.5 million in incremental greens-fee revenue. Of the 5 million rounds tracked in 2018, 73% were played within five minutes of target goal times and pace improved by as much as 30 minutes.

“A recent USGA survey shows 74% of players believe appropriate speed is critical to enjoying their rounds,” says Bodo Sieber, CEO of Tagmarshal. “Our real-time intelligence provides operators with invaluable data that increases golfer satisfaction and business profits.”

Tagmarshal is utilized by more than 150 golf courses in nine countries. Those trusting Tagmarshal include Carnoustie (site of the 2018 Open Championship), Pinehurst Resort & Country Club (2019 U.S Amateur Championship), The Ocean Course at Kiawah Island Golf Resort (2021 PGA Championship), Whistling Straits (2020 Ryder Cup), Erin Hills (2017 U.S. Open), East Lake (2018 TOUR Championship) and Valhalla (2014 PGA Championship).

In addition to marquee golf courses, dozens with greens and cart fees less than $50 also benefit from Tagmarshal. By pre-empting golfer logjams and creating more efficient monitoring programs, more tees times are created. The net annual gain is as much as $40,000 per course, validating Tagmarshal’s affordability.

“We are continuously looking for ways to improve our on-course capabilities and create more memorable experiences for guests,” says Matt Barksdale, PGA, Resort Head Golf Professional at Pinehurst Resort & Country Club. “The adoption of Tagmarshal has been seamless and the system has already produced positive insights for us to implement.”

Superintendents embracing Tagmarshal’s technological innovations have been positioning their courses as pace setters in the industry. Comparing player and hole performance data over time enables partners to proactively adjust operations, including better management of pin placements, wear patterns, hole set-ups and labor expenses.

Tagmarshal’s Bodo Sieber on industry data experts panel at Golf TechCon 2018

TAGMARSHALS BODO SIEBER ON INDUSTRY DATA EXPERTS PANEL AT GOLF TECHCON 2018

With advances in golf course technology becoming more and more critical in the day to day operations of a golf course, the National Golf Course Owners Association (NGCOA), invited industry experts, for a thought leading panel discussion to provide insight on data collection, analysis, and opportunities for a round of golf. The panel was part of Golf Business Tech Conference which took place in Las Vegas October 10-11th.

Bodo Sieber, CEO of Tagmarshal, together with Scot Forbis, GM, Europe and Client Product Strategy at EZLinks Golf, Bryan Lord, CEO of Teesnap, and Kyle Ragsdale, Managing Director of Buffalo Agency were featured speakers during this year’s Golf TechCon event, held in Las Vegas, Nevada.

Golf Business TechCon is the golf industry’s only event specifically designed to showcase golf course technology. This educational, instructional two-day event allowed golf course owners, operators and other industry professionals to experience some of the tools, tactics, and techniques currently transforming golf course operations.

The discussion entitled “Collecting and Analyzing Data: From A to Z” was moderated by Hunki Yun, Director of Partnerships, Outreach and Education at the USGA, and discussed how golf course operators can capture, track, and analyze behavioral data about golfers, segment them into relevant targeted groups, and then use the information to get them to “do” more of what they want.
